Ceramic Engineeringdoctorate programs are on the lower end of the spectrum in terms of popularity. In fact, the major degree program ranks #201 out of the 295 majors we look at each year. While this may limit the number of schools that offer the degree program, there are still top-quality ones to be found.

College Factual looked at 2 colleges and universities when compiling its 2022 Most Popular Doctor's Degree Colleges for Ceramic Engineering in the Middle Atlantic Region ranking. Combined, these schools handed out 5 doctor's degrees in ceramic engineering to qualified students.

Alfred University is one of the most popular schools in the United States for getting a doctor's degree in ceramic engineering. Located in the remote town of Alfred, Alfred is a private not-for-profit university with a small student population. Potential students might also be interested to know that the school ranks #1 in quality for doctor's degrees in ceramic engineering in New York.
